In the realm of plastering and finishing work, the right tool can make all the difference in achieving a professional and polished result. The Plastering Finishing Trowel, specifically the Notched Trowel, is a specialized tool designed to provide a textured or grooved finish to surfaces, adding both aesthetic appeal and functionality.

The Notched Trowel, also known as a ribbed or fluted trowel, features a series of evenly spaced notches or ribs along the length of its blade. These notches are crucial for creating a consistent pattern on the surface being worked on. Whether it's for decorative purposes or to enhance the grip and durability of the finished surface, the notches play a significant role.

One of the primary uses of a Notched Trowel is in the application of cementitious materials like stucco or plaster. By dragging the trowel across the wet surface, the notches leave a series of parallel grooves, which can help to hide minor imperfections and create a visually appealing texture. This is particularly useful in exterior applications where the surface may be subject to weathering and wear.

The Notched Trowel is also favored for its ability to control the thickness of the applied material. The depth of the notches can be adjusted to suit the desired finish, allowing for precise control over the amount of material used. This not only contributes to a more professional-looking finish but also helps to reduce waste and material costs.

In terms of construction, a high-quality Notched Trowel is typically made from durable materials such as stainless steel or carbon steel. The choice of material can affect the trowel's weight, durability, and resistance to rust. A well-crafted trowel will have a comfortable handle, often made from wood or plastic, designed to reduce fatigue during extended use.

Maintenance of a Notched Trowel is essential for prolonging its lifespan. After each use, it's important to clean the trowel thoroughly to remove any dried material. This prevents the notches from becoming clogged and ensures the trowel remains in good working condition.
